[fcm] EHS - Prs Officer (Environment, Health

Hanoi, Hanoi Công Ty TNHH Bosch Global Software Technologies

Posted today

Job Viewed

Tap Again To Close

Job Description

**Mô tả công việc**:
(Mức lương: Thỏa thuận)

EHS - Environment, Health, Safety (70%)
- Implement Labor safety training and Fire Fighting and First Aid Training.
- Document control Coordinator for EHS MS
- Support Fire Safety and Fire Response plan
- EHS-Partner of departments
- Implement occupational environmental monitoring and analyze data, Waste management, Carry out EHS Patrol
- Update and evaluate legal requirements on EHS
- Follow up inspection of equipment with strict safety requirements
- Manage hazardous substance management, contractor management procedure
- Support to investigate and report incidents
- Involve in EHS internal/external audits

PRS - Protection and Security (30%)
- Set up and improve PRS process as Bosch requirements
- Manage security guards, make plan and carry out the security patrol
- Investigate security incident and make report
- Maintain asset database
- Manage hardware and software for APE and CCTV system
- Manage access cards and ID card printing
- Support Management to deploy PRS policies and objectives
- Support Management to ensure PRS compliance
- Coordinates with the region on PRS matters
- Make plan and coordinate PRS internal/external audits
